About the Company

Over the last eight years, Open Eye Scientific has developed the field’s most advanced large-scale compute platform, Orion, built on Amazon Web Services. In this position, you will be working at the cutting edge of cloud computing, C++/Python development, and advanced MD simulation techniques. Your work will have the potential to make a major impact in drug discovery, and will be available to many pharmaceutical and biotech companies.

Open Eye, Cadence Molecular Sciences – a division of Cadence Design Systems – is an industry leader in computational molecular design through rapid, robust, and scalable software, consulting services, and Orion®, the only cloud-native fully integrated software-as-a-service molecular modeling platform. Combining unlimited computation and storage with powerful tools for data sharing, visualization and analysis in a customizable development platform, Orion offers unprecedented capabilities for the advancement of pharmaceuticals, biologics, agrochemicals, and flavors and fragrances.

Open Eye, Cadence Molecular Sciences is headquartered in Santa Fe, N.M., with offices in Boston, Mass.;
Cologne, Germany; and Tokyo, Japan.

What You’ll Do
  • Develop highly scalable and integrated workflows for relative binding free energy workflows in lead optimization.
  • Explore machine learning models such as 3D-QSAR using large-scale relative binding free energy calculations.
  • Develop data-driven models using 2D cheminformatics and 3D molecular shape representations.
  • Work on retrospective and prospective projects both internally and with collaborators to validate methodologies.
  • Work with Orion project team to further optimize compound design workflows in Orion.
What You Should Have
  • PhD (or equivalent experience) in computational chemistry, chemistry, or related field with 0 – 5 years relevant experience.
  • Knowledge of molecular dynamics simulations, binding free energy calculations, protein-ligand interactions, or machine learning.
  • Experience in designing hypothesis-driven computational experiments, and data-driven decision making.
  • Programming expertise, ideally in Python, preferably with experience using AI coding agents.
  • Experience in or desire to learn about the pharmaceutical industry.
  • Strong desire to learn about customer problems and find practical solutions.
  • Demonstrated ability to work both as part of a team and independently.
Optional Qualifications (Plus)
  • Experience with Open Eye software/toolkits.
  • Expertise with traditional machine learning and modern deep learning methods.
  • Experience with synthetically accessible, pharmaceutically relevant generative chemistry.
